vikki7474
We tried this place today, the Kolache’s are okay, not enough flavor for my taste but the breakfast combo is a good deal. My kids liked the fruit kolache’s but my daughter said it tasted like some kind of pie filling. BUT….. They took an extreme long time (over 45 minutes) then they tried to get us with the waffles…. For $7 and some change they attempted to give us 2 toaster waffles with whipped cream and some not so fresh fruit, needless to say I got a refund for those bootleg waffles (photo attached) and I won’t EVER order those again. Kolache Shake step your waffle game up, you can get waffle makers under $20 and the waffle mix is crazy inexpensive….. Do better ‍♀️ .

Anthony Cialdella
I once gave this place a 5-Star Review and while the quality of the food is still great, the service is severely lacking. We were told our visit would be 25 minutes. Our order was completed in 1 hour and when asked about the delay we were informed that “there were other customers they also had to take care of”. I can sympathize with being understaffed, but being lied to and then given an excuse with an attitude is unacceptable. I was told I’ll be receiving a full refund but staff never asked my name or to re-run my card, so I’m not at all confident I’ll receive it. Sadly, this will be my last visit.

Kevin Whitlock
I gave this 1 star only because “zero” is not an option. Having moved here from central Texas I was excited to see the Authentic Texas Sausage and Cheese Kolache on the menu. I wish I’d never seen it. This was the absolute Gawdawfullest excuse for a kolache I have ever experienced. Kolache Shack should be embarrassed to offer this on their menu if that’s the best they can do. It was way overcooked. It was as dry as the desert and hard and crusty. Any cheese had run out the bottom and burned to crisp. The roll was way too coarse and savory for a Kolache. The ratio of sausage to bread was too high. I’m having trouble finding the words to express how bad this was. Please remove this item from your menu. You’re giving this delight a bad name.
